First Aid Measures
Emergency procedures for chemical exposure incidents
If breathed in, move person into fresh air. If not breathing, give artificial respiration. Consult a physician.
Wash off with soap and plenty of water. Consult a physician.
Rinse thoroughly with plenty of water for at least 15 minutes and consult a physician.
Never give anything by mouth to an unconscious person. Rinse mouth with water. Consult a physician.
Immediate Medical Attention
Consult a physician.
Firefighting Measures
Extinguishing media, specific hazards, and firefighter protection
Use water spray, alcohol-resistant foam, dry chemical or carbon dioxide.
Carbon oxides, Nitrogen oxides (NOx), Hydrogen chloride gas
Firefighter Protection
Wear self-contained breathing apparatus for firefighting if necessary.
Accidental Release Measures
Spill cleanup procedures, containment, and environmental protection
Use personal protective equipment. Avoid dust formation. Avoid breathing vapors, mist or gas. Ensure adequate ventilation. Evacuate personnel to safe areas. Avoid breathing dust.
Do not let product enter drains.
Pick up and arrange disposal without creating dust. Sweep up and shovel.
Materials: suitable, closed containers

Handling and Storage
Safe handling precautions, storage conditions, and workplace requirements
Avoid contact with skin and eyes. Avoid formation of dust and aerosols.
Keep container tightly closed in a dry and well-ventilated place. Store in cool place.
Handle in accordance with good industrial hygiene and safety practice. Wash hands before breaks and at the end of workday.
Provide appropriate exhaust ventilation at places where dust is formed.
Exposure Controls / PPE
Occupational exposure limits, engineering controls, and protective equipment
Handle with gloves. Gloves must be inspected prior to use. Use proper glove removal technique (without touching glove's outer surface) to avoid skin contact with this product. Dispose of contaminated gloves after use in accordance with applicable laws and good laboratory practices. Wash and dry hands. The selected protective gloves have to satisfy the specifications of Regulation (EU) 2016/425 and the standard EN 374 derived from it. Full contact Material: Nitrile rubber Minimum layer thickness: 0,11 mm Break through time: 480 min Material tested: Dermatril® (KCL 740 / Aldrich Z677272, Size M) Splash contact Material: Nitrile rubber Minimum layer thickness: 0,11 mm Break through time: 480 min Material tested: Dermatril® (KCL 740 / Aldrich Z677272, Size M) data source: KCL GmbH, D-36124 Eichenzell, phone +49 (0)6659 87300, e-mail sales@kcl.de, test method: EN374 If used in solution, or mixed with other substances, and under conditions which differ from EN 374, contact the supplier of the EC approved gloves. This recommendation is advisory only and must be evaluated by an industrial hygienist and safety officer familiar with the specific situation of anticipated use by our customers. It should not be construed as offering an approval for any specific use scenario.
Safety glasses with side-shields conforming to EN166 Use equipment for eye protection tested and approved under appropriate government standards such as NIOSH (US) or EN 166(EU).
For nuisance exposures use type P95 (US) or type P1 (EU EN 143) particle respirator.For higher level protection use type OV/AG/P99 (US) or type ABEK-P2 (EU EN 143) respirator cartridges. Use respirators and components tested and approved under appropriate government standards such as NIOSH (US) or CEN (EU).
Complete suit protecting against chemicals, The type of protective equipment must be selected according to the concentration and amount of the dangerous substance at the specific workplace.
Do not let product enter drains.

What are the hazard statements for Serotonin hydrochloride?
This substance has 4 hazard statements:
- H302 + H312 + H332: Harmful if swallowed, in contact with skin or if inhaled.
- H315: Causes skin irritation.
- H319: Causes serious eye irritation.
- H335: May cause respiratory irritation.
